Key Insights:
Key management, not encryption algorithms, is the primary cause of key encryption failures. 🗝️
Establishing a key rotation period based on the quantity of data encrypted is crucial for data security. 🔑
Recommendations suggest rotating keys between 64GB and 1TB of data encrypted to a single key, depending on data sensitivity. 🔄
Whole drive encryption may allow for higher quantities of data encrypted to a single key, requiring different key rotation considerations. 📁
Considering the amount of data encrypted to a single key is essential in determining an effective key rotation schedule. 📊
